Trinity Baseball Wins At Bowdoin In NESCAC Opener

Orono, Maine - The Trinity College Bantam baseball team defeated the Bowdoin College Polar Bears, 5-3, on Friday afternoon in the New England Small College Athletic Conference (NESCAC) East-opening contest for both squads.   The Bantams, ranked No. 4 in the nation, improve to 10-2, while the Polar Bears dip to 10-9. The game was played at Mahaney Diamond on the campus of the University of Maine due to unplayable field conditions in Brunswick. The teams will play a doubleheader in Orono on Saturday beginning at noon.

Trinity jumped out to a 3-0 lead after three and a half innings before Bowdoin was able to trim the lead to 3-2 in the bottom of the fourth. The Bantams extended their lead with single runs in the seventh and eighth inning en route to victory. Ryan Piacentini led Trinity with three hits while Kent Graham, Alex LiDonni and Alexander Rokicki each connected for doubles for the Bantams. Adam Marquit also had an RBI single for the Polar Bears.  Jeremiah Bayer went the distance to collect the win for Trinity while Pat Driscoll was tagged with the loss for Bowdoin.
